Имя: Пароль:
1C
 
Не верная сумма в запросе
Ø (mehfk 24.10.2017 11:42)
0 falselight
 
24.10.17
11:41
Запрос выводит количество отгруженных ЗаказовКлиента
и сумму по полю Сумма табличной части документа.
Группировка идет по Менеджеру. Сделал аналогичные настройки
списка в ФормеСпискаДокумента. Количество верное 3 документа.
Открываю каждый, смотрю сумму строки и суммирую.
Запрос показывает по одному из менеджеров, по которому смотрю
пример, - 32490. А в сумме строк 12230.
Подскажите почему не верная сумма в запросе?
Как его можно поправить?
||


ВЫБРАТЬ
    СостоянияЗаказовКлиентов.Заказ.Менеджер,
    КОЛИЧЕСТВО(РАЗЛИЧНЫЕ ЕСТЬNULL(СостоянияЗаказовКлиентов.Заказ.Ссылка, 0)) КАК КоличествоОтгруженныхЗаказов,
    СУММА(ЕСТЬNULL(ЗаказКлиентаТовары.Сумма, 0)) КАК СуммаОтгрузки
ИЗ
    РегистрСведений.СостоянияЗаказовКлиентов КАК СостоянияЗаказовКлиентов
        ЛЕВОЕ СОЕДИНЕНИЕ Документ.ЗаказКлиента.ДополнительныеРеквизиты КАК ЗаказКлиентаДополнительныеРеквизиты
        ПО СостоянияЗаказовКлиентов.Заказ.Ссылка = ЗаказКлиентаДополнительныеРеквизиты.Ссылка
        ЛЕВОЕ СОЕДИНЕНИЕ Документ.ЗаказКлиента.Товары КАК ЗаказКлиентаТовары
        ПО СостоянияЗаказовКлиентов.Заказ.Ссылка = ЗаказКлиентаТовары.Ссылка
ГДЕ
    СостоянияЗаказовКлиентов.Заказ.Дата МЕЖДУ &НачДата И &КонДата
    И СостоянияЗаказовКлиентов.Состояние = &Закрыт
    И СостоянияЗаказовКлиентов.ПроцентОтгрузки = 100
    И СостоянияЗаказовКлиентов.Заказ.ПометкаУдаления = ЛОЖЬ
    И СостоянияЗаказовКлиентов.Заказ.Проведен = ИСТИНА

СГРУППИРОВАТЬ ПО
    СостоянияЗаказовКлиентов.Заказ.Менеджер
1 mehfk
 
24.10.17
11:42